CCTV News:In March this year, the State Council issued the Action Plan for Promoting Large-scale Equipment Renewal and Trade-in of Consumer Goods. Subsequently, the Ministry of Commerce and other departments successively issued the Action Plan for Promoting Trade-in of Consumer Goods and the Implementation Rules for Automobile Trade-in Subsidies. Various localities have successively issued implementation plans and introduced policies such as subsidies and concessions.

In the past two months, the reporter visited and found that, driven by the policy, the number of consumers who are willing to redeem has increased significantly. However, some consumers have encountered difficulties in recycling. In particular, some old large household appliances are difficult to handle. Where are the blocking points and difficulties? How to make consumers "easier to get rid of the old and more willing to replace the new"? Let’s take a look at the difficult problems in home appliance recycling.

Mr Meng, who lives in Beijing, wants to buy a new refrigerator recently, but the old refrigerator has not been disposed of. "This refrigerator cost more than 1,000 yuan when it was bought. It has been used for three or four years. Now it looks a little small, and it is a bit old. I want to change it to a new one, but I found a recycler and only agreed to receive the goods from 20 yuan. This is too cheap."

Shang Libo, a citizen of Qingdao, also said: "When the washing machine was bought at that time, it was more than 4,000 yuan. Now it is only a few tens of dollars to check the recycling on the Internet. There is also a refrigerator, which was also three or four thousand yuan when it was bought. Now it is only ten pieces and eight pieces to recycle. People say no, it is not enough to lift it down, so heavy."

Why is the recycling price so low? The reporter saw a car of used household appliances being unloaded at this recycling point.

In the interview, the reporter learned that recyclers will not refer to the brand and market price when recycling used household appliances, but only evaluate them according to the size and transportation distance of used household appliances. In Beijing and other cities, because of the high rent and remote location of transit sites, the recycling cost is high. The difficulty of small cities is mainly that there are fewer recycling outlets and there are no large-scale and standardized recycling enterprises.

Shi Feng, deputy manager of China Renewable Resources and Environment Co., Ltd. said: "At present, the enthusiasm of the operators at the recycling end and the front end is not particularly high, and the profits are relatively low." 

Why does the replacement of used household appliances emphasize "recycling" at the same time?

In fact, in this round of documents related to promoting the trade-in of consumer goods, it is also mentioned that it is necessary to improve the recycling system of used household appliances. Why should we emphasize recycling? What is the value of recycled waste household appliances?

In this waste household appliance dismantling factory in Yutian, Hebei, the reporter saw that workers were skillfully dismantling refrigerators on the assembly line. Here, 3 million sets of waste household appliances can be dismantled every year, and 60,000 tons of resources can be recovered. After that, these recycled materials extracted from waste household appliances will be transported to manufacturing enterprises to become raw materials for new products.

Experts say that renewable resources are an effective supplement to primary resources. In 2023, China recycled about 260 million tons of waste steel, which ensured more than 20% of crude steel production needs. Up to now, the number of household appliances such as refrigerators, washing machines and air conditioners in China has exceeded 3 billion. Every year, 100 million to 120 million used household appliances are eliminated. If these used household appliances are not disposed of properly, it will harm our environment.

Zhu Liyang, president of China Circular Economy Association, said: "Waste household appliances contain a lot of heavy metals such as lead and mercury, and hazardous wastes such as fluorescent powder and waste oil. If they are dismantled through informal channels, it will increase the risk of environmental pollution and cause serious waste of resources."

Experts said that waste household appliances entering the standardized recycling channel can not only reduce potential safety hazards and promote consumption, but also save resources, promote energy conservation and carbon reduction and protect the environment.

Now, it seems that low price, few outlets, and no one coming to recycle are the "embarrassing" problems encountered in the replacement of home appliances. How to get through this blocking point and smooth the consumption cycle of household appliances renewal? What are the practices in various places? Let’s go to Hangzhou, Zhejiang first.

Zhang Xiaoyi, who lives in Yuhang District, can’t use his computer because it is old and damaged. Under the recommendation of the community, he made an appointment for recycling used household appliances from the mobile phone applet. The staff of the recycling company came to the door soon, and Zhang Xiaoyi got the environmental protection fund from 20 yuan.

These waste household appliances will be clearly marked on the mobile phone applet. After recycling, they will be transported to the sorting center for sorting and warehousing, waiting to be sent to the downstream for dismantling and sales. Each household appliance will be labeled with a QR code, and the staff can scan it and enter the relevant information into the big data platform.

At present, Hangzhou, Zhejiang Province has established a whole chain of waste household appliances recycling from user recycling, transportation to dismantling enterprises. The reporter learned from the Yuhang District Bureau of Commerce that in 2023, only Yuhang District recycled more than 82,000 tons of used household appliances, and the retail sales of household appliances exceeded 5.76 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 43.5%.

"One-stop" for recycling, dismantling and reuse of recycling factories in home appliance enterprises

In Shandong, not only did the government implement relevant reward and compensation programs to help household appliances trade in old ones, but some household appliance enterprises also used their own production lines and logistics advantages to establish a more sophisticated recycling system for used household appliances. Let’s watch together.

In Laixi, Qingdao, Shandong Province, this home appliance recycling interconnection factory, which integrates "recycling, disassembly, regeneration and reuse", iron, aluminum, copper, some hard plastics, wires and wires produced by dismantling waste home appliances can be utilized as resources.

The person in charge calculated an account for us: taking a 220-liter refrigerator as an example, about 9 kilograms of plastic, 38.6 kilograms of iron, 0.6 kilograms of aluminum and 1.4 kilograms of copper can be produced after disassembly and circulation; A drum washing machine can remove about 11 kilograms of plastic, 23 kilograms of iron, 1.5 kilograms of copper and 0.5 kilograms of aluminum. These materials can be recycled.

Household appliance stores integrate resources for new ones and collect old ones at the same time.

In order to make it easier for people to replace their home appliances with new ones, many shopping malls and e-commerce platforms have now launched a one-stop service of "buy+collect old ones". Whether online or offline, when buying a new machine, just fill in the old model and express logistics personnel can come to the door for recycling.

In this home appliance store in Beijing, the salesperson told the reporter that recently, according to Beijing’s old-for-new subsidy policy and the preferential conditions of home appliance manufacturers, a home appliance can be given a maximum discount of 15%. At the same time, the price of used household appliances evaluated by small programs can be deducted to buy new machines. Household appliances that used to cost 10,000 yuan can now be cheaper than 1,500 yuan through trade-in, and manufacturers have also introduced convenient services. Users only need to move their fingers on their mobile phones to complete the replacement.
